What Does an Electrician Do?

An electrician is an expert who makes sure that electrical systems of people function properly. They install new equipment, fix damaged wiring and fuse boxes as well as maintain electric lines.

The skilled tradespeople work as a team to complete their job. They may also be self-employed and establish their own schedules.

Job description

Electricians install, test, repair and maintain electrical wiring, fixtures, control devices and other equipment in all kinds of buildings and other structures. They are employed by electrical contractors and departments for building maintenance or may be self-employed.

They receive work orders concerning electrical systems, respond to urgent phone calls, and complete electrical projects that are built on blueprints or specifications. They also monitor power levels to electrical circuits, and ensure that circuits will not be overloaded or create a risk. They can order electrical parts and supplies, and communicate with vendors regarding the type and availability of products and also perform other business management duties.

Journeyman electricians must establish and maintain the electrical infrastructure of the building. This includes the installation of new wiring fixtures, systems, and other tasks. They also assist in troubleshooting issues that arise with electrical systems, and repair and replacing appliances, as well as other equipment, and making sure that the system is compliant with OSHA safety standards.

Education and training requirements

Electricians are experts in the installation, maintenance and repair of electrical systems in homes and businesses. They also repair electrical devices like street lights and traffic signals that keep motorists safe.

You will need to be trained in all aspects of the trade to become an electrician. This includes the ability to read circuit diagrams and also follow the safety guidelines and electrical codes. Additionally, electricians uk must be able to use tools, such as a multimeter, correctly and safely.


Some schools offer specializations that are specific to certain sectors of the industry. They can be in solar energy or wind turbine technology, for instance and can help you find a career that best suits your interests.

Apprenticeships are the most commonly used method of becoming an electrician. It is a four-year program that combines classroom education with on-the-job training, under the supervision of a certified electrician. After completing the apprenticeship students receive a certificate as a journeyman or journeyperson. Students can opt to complete a master apprenticeship or continue their education and earn additional certifications.

Another popular option for electricians who are aspiring is an associate degree that lasts two years or a certificate in electrical engineering/technology. These programs give students an excellent foundation in the field of electrical engineering and allow them to quickly transition into an apprenticeship.

Other options for education include an undergraduate degree, a master's degree, or a doctorate. Whatever route you choose you'll need a license to practice. Each state has different requirements for licensing and it's recommended to call the department of labor in your area for more information.

Work environment

Electricians install maintenance, repair, and install electrical systems that control lighting as well as communications equipment used in homes, businesses and factories. The job is physically demanding, as it may require standing, kneeling, or stooping for long periods of time. It is also risky with injuries that can include electrical shocks, falls, burns, and cuts.

Due to the dangers, OSHA sets specific standards to protect workers from dangers. These standards include a requirement that all employees follow strict safety guidelines and wear protective clothing, equipment and eyewear.

Most electricians go through an apprenticeship that lasts for four or five years. It includes classroom instruction and practical on-the-job training, which helps them acquire the skills to complete tasks successfully. They learn how to drill holes, set anchors and connect conduit. They also learn how to put in wiring outlets, switches and outlets and draw diagrams of electrical systems.

During an apprenticeship, electricians must pass an examination for drugs and pass an aptitude test. They must also be at 18 years old, and have a high school diploma or equivalent.
